Governor`s Critics Plan To Offer Their Own Education Plans

Educators and legislators intend to offer their own education reform plans to compete with the revamped proposal Governor Huckabee unveiled this week. Groups involved in the education debate remain uncertain whether a consensus can be reached before a possible December special legislative session. Some say a lot will depend on how much Huckabee is willing to compromise on his revamped reform plan. Charles Knox, spokesman for the Arkansas Association of Educational Administrators, says the new plan looks a lot like one that failed during the regular session. Knox says his organization is working to develop its own education reform proposal based on an efficiency standard that school districts must meet. The Arkansas Rural Educators Association plans to offer another proposal. And two legislators who opposed Huckabee`s plan drafted their own revised plan.
